If you want to stretch your hairstyle an extra day but your hair is looking a little tired, opt for a Bardot-inspired updo, such as a chignon, bouffant, or ponytail. Emmanuel Esteban recommends using the Bardot Lift + Volume Spray to help you achieve Brigitte Bardot's stylish bouffant (per Savoir Flair). If you don't want to invest in new products, any volume spray you have on hand will work. Make sure your hair is freshly washed and still damp, then spray the roots of your hair with your selected product. Next, be sure to apply a heat protectant spray closer to the middle and ends of your hair. Esteban told Savoir Flair that a paddle brush with "natural bristles" is his go-to when it comes to a seamless blow dry.

Bardot's hairstyle has a lot of volume at the crown of the head, so this is where you should focus your teasing. Take a small section at the crown and begin combing the hair towards the root. To avoid getting your hair tangled or matted, start by only backcombing an inch away from the roots, and slowly work your way outward until you're backcombing several inches from the root. As you are teasing, take pauses to see how much volume you've created — a little bit of teasing can go a long way.

If you want a good hairstyle that can last you several days, always start with properly cleaned and prepped hair. For a voluminous Brigitte Bardot hairstyle, that means thoroughly shampooing your roots. Oil and grease weigh your roots down and diminish volume, but if you use a volumizing shampoo, you can clean that gunk out and give your roots a helpful boost.
